How much do senior python eng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 11, 2026, the average yearly pay for senior python engineer in New Britain, CT is $140,426.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$120,200.00 and $161,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Are senior Python engineers in demand?

Senior Python engineers are highly in demand due to the language's widespread use in web development, data analysis, machine learning, and automation. Companies seek experienced developers with strong problem-solving skills and knowledge of frameworks like Django or Flask, making this a competitive and growing field.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a senior Python eng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Senior Python Engineer, you need expert knowledge of Python programming, software architecture, and experience with web frameworks, supported by a degree in computer science or related field. Familiarity with tools like Django, Flask, REST APIs, Docker, and version control systems such as Git is typically required, along with possible certifications in cloud technologies or Python itself. Strong problem-solving abilities, leadership, and effective communication skills help you lead teams and collaborate across departments. These skills ensure robust, scalable software solutions and foster innovation and efficiency within development projects.

What does a senior Python engineer do?

A Senior Python Engineer is an experienced software developer who specializes in designing, developing, and maintaining applications using the Python programming language. They often take on leadership roles within development teams, contribute to architectural decisions, and mentor junior engineers. Senior Python Engineers work on complex projects, ensure code quality, and help implement best practices to improve efficiency and reliability. Their work may span back-end development, data engineering, automation, and integrating with other technologies.

What are the common challenges senior Python engineers face when leading projects, and how can they effectively address them?

Senior Python Engineers often encounter challenges such as balancing hands-on coding with overseeing project architecture, mentoring junior developers, and ensuring code quality across the team. Effectively addressing these challenges involves strong communication, setting clear coding standards, and fostering a collaborative environment through regular code reviews and knowledge-sharing sessions. Staying updated on best practices and leveraging automation tools for testing and deployment can also help streamline workflows and maintain high-quality deliverables.

Job Title: Sr. Python Data Engineer (Python, MongoDB, PowerBI and Data Extraction, ability to write code)
Location: Hartford, CT
Position type: W2 contract 
Duration: 12+ months extendable.

Mandatory skills:
Strong Python candidate having exp in Mondo DB, PowerBI and Data ExtractionOverview

We are seeking a motivated and skilled Data Engineer to join our team. The ideal candidate will have strong proficiency in Python, knowledge of MongoDB, and experience with Power BI. This role will primarily focus on building data extracts and data feeds for downstream systems, including Ledger, Reporting, and Boudreaux. You will be responsible for writing the code necessary to deliver the required data based on predefined definitions

Responsibilities:

  •  Data Extraction and Transformation: Write efficient and scalable Python code to extract and transform data from various sources, ensuring it meets the requirements for downstream systems.
  • MongoDB Management: Utilize MongoDB for storing and managing data. Design and optimize data models and queries to ensure high performance and reliability.
  • Power BI Integration: Collaborate with stakeholders to deliver data in a format suitable for reporting and visualization in Power BI. Ensure that the data aligns with business needs and reporting requirements.
  • Data Feed Development: Develop and maintain data feeds for downstream systems, including Ledger and Boudreaux, ensuring timely and accurate data delivery.
  • Collaboration with Stakeholders: Work closely with business analysts and other stakeholders to understand data definitions and requirements, translating them into technical specifications.
  • Documentation: Maintain comprehensive documentation of data pipelines, data models, and technical specifications to support knowledge sharing and compliance.
  • Quality Assurance: Implement data validation and quality checks to ensure the accuracy and integrity of the data being delivered.

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Data Engineering, Information Technology, or a related field.
  • Minimum of 9 years of experience in data engineering or a related field.
  • Strong experience in Python programming, particularly in data manipulation and ETL processes.
  • Solid knowledge of MongoDB and experience in database design and management.
  • Familiarity with Power BI for creating reports and dashboards.
  • Experience in building data extracts and feeds for business applications.
  • Analytical Skills: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with a focus on delivering high-quality data solutions.
  • Communication: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to clearly convey technical concepts to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Team Player: Ability to work collaboratively in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ment.
